What is a New Zealand toastie?

What is a New Zealand toastie?

NZ Herald. The toasted cheese sandwich, or toastie as it’s more commonly known, has been enjoyed by generations around the world. The dish is seemingly simple, generally containing cheese, potentially some ham, tomato and onion, or even a bit of spaghetti (here’s looking at you, Bill).

What are Toasties called in Australia?

Jaffle
A Jaffle is the Australian name for a closed toasted sandwich.

    What are British Toasties?

    The British like things on toast, right? Toasties, or toasted sandwiches, are merely an extension of that love, and they are big in the U.K.—particularly when filled with cheese, making it a cheese toastie and quite the same as what many of us would call “grilled cheese”: a hot, gooey cheese sandwich.

    What is the best bread for a toastie?

    White bread is your friend Instead, you want something a little thinner, a little more yielding. While a soft white sliced loaf will always have my toastie heart, most bloomers and granary loaves will work well, as will paninis (obviously) and ciabattas.

    What is buttered toast?

    The buttered toast phenomenon is an observation that buttered toast tends to land butter-side down after it falls. It is used as an idiom representing pessimistic outlooks. Various people have attempted to determine whether there is an actual tendency for bread to fall in this fashion, with varying results.
